A city that is historically rich and good. The old meddinah is everything in Fes. It's very beautiful. Other than that, there isn't much to do. I recommend staying for 2 days to 3 days most. It's more than enough. The locals are generally friendly. But the taxis are hard to get, especially if you are more than 2 people. They can even scam you and raise the fare. So be careful.

Meknes is more traditional & laid back than Fes.

Meknes is more traditional & laid back than Fes. The business people are less aggressive in trying to sell you something & it was easy to navigate around the city. Plenty of interesting architecture, Médina gates and nice places to eat.

Not much happening in this town.

Not much happening in this town. Hard to find good restaurants. Most places seem to serve fast food. Probably the biggest draw is the proximity to Ifrane National Park and the famous Barbary macaques. They are easily spotted on the road N13 leading into town mainly because people like to feed them there so there are plenty to see.

The Medina is the big draw here and one could spend a whole...

The Medina is the big draw here and one could spend a whole day just wandering amongst the many alleyways and shops taking in the atmosphere, sights and sounds. That said there is a lot of repetitive tourist tat and fruit\meat stalls. I was disappointed by the tannery, not much work going on outside (supposedly now all done inside) though there was hardly any smell. Surprisingly we were not hassled too much by any shop owner and haggling for a lower price was not aggressive. One day is enough in Fes and add another day for a trip out to Volubilis and you're done IMHO. We stayed 3 days in all and this was more than enough.

Interesting medina, market and main square.

Interesting medina, market and main square. Short (free) visit to mausoleum is main event, otherwise not a lot to do. Probably 1 day/night is sufficient. Use as a base for half day visit to Volubolis. Limited decent restaurants , most are in Riads. A restaurant with a terrace with nice views exists on inside of gateway near main gate
